  8. Hello! This model was finished on the first half of 2019, and was published on the June issue of Airfix Model World. It`s the Special Hobby offering of the C-212 Aviocar. This build had a special impact in me. These Aircraft saved a lot of lives on the archipelago of Azores (were i live) transporting patients from the smaller islands to the ones with hospital. There are even some Azoreans born aboard the Aviocar! The kit is well detailed and the decals stunning. The presence of putty on the lower surface of the fuselage is mainly due to a mistake of the modeller. I used paints from the Vallejo and Mission Model Paints ranges. Hope you like it! José Pedro
